**Evacuation-Chair Store — Night Shift Guidance**

The evacuation-chair store is the small cupboard beside Stairwell B on Level 4 of Harlowe Court. It holds two chairs and spare straps; please confirm both are present at the start of each night shift and note any faults in the shift log. The cupboard stays locked outside drills and emergencies. To unlock it, enter the code below.

badge for hawip-taweg: bdg-QFZSW-38965

Lanternkit, our shared component library, will adopt strict semver with a compatibility manifest per package. Breaking changes require a migration note and a two-sprint deprecation window. Consumers pin minor versions; the Driftwatch bot opens upgrade PRs automatically. To keep the bot's cadence and batching predictable across repos, we centralized its scheduling knobs, listed here.

tuning table, yajog-yahof:
BUDGETS = {
    "lamvan": 303,
    "wenox": 460,
    "fenvan": 525,
}

RUNBOOK — GALLERY LABEL MOVE
Shift lead: stage the Harrowfield Gallery label crates on dock 3 by 06:30. Labels for the new Tidemark Wing are printed on brittle stock — no stacking above two high. Verify count against the Lanwick Print manifest before sealing. Pallet wrap only, no strapping across crate lids. Driver from Corvane Couriers arrives 07:15; load rear-first. Confirm the dock log is signed before release. The courier hand-over instruction below is confidential and must follow exactly.

courier memo of yawep-yafog: the pramir ulaix courier leaves the ulavan aldix frair zorok oliiel joreth rusdor fenvan ledger at gate 1305 under passcode 514738

## Account Recovery — Trailnote Offline Mode

When a surveyor's Trailnote app has been offline for 30+ days, their local credentials expire and sync refuses to resume. Don't make them wipe the device — all their unsynced field data lives there! Instead, open the support console, pick "Offline Reinstate," and enter their handle. The console will ask for the support team's shared recovery passphrase before issuing a reinstatement token. Use the one below.

unlock words, bagaf-fajeg: zorael-kelax-fraath-quenix-eliok-sileth-aldmir-wenir-druiel